The Crown, Amersham
A Grade II listed building, this former coaching inn in Buckinghamshire dates back to the 16th century. Set in the picturesque town of Old Amersham, the Tudor beams, open fireplaces and rustic interiors emit a warm atmosphere - perhaps a reason it was chosen for the famous bedroom scene in 1994 hit film Four Weddings and a Funeral, starring Hugh Grant and Andie MacDowell.
Ask for Room 101, and you'll spend the night in the famous room. The hotel showcases an Elizabethan exterior and retains many original features, including a 16th-century mural.
